Exactly how are you going about changing your clothes?

If you click "Add", the clothing layer or attachment will simply be added to whatever you're currently wearing.

If you click "Wear", the item will displace the current clothing layer or the attachment on that attach point.

If you click "Replace Current Outfit", the thing(s) you've selected will be worn, but ALL your current clothes and attachments, save shape, skin, eyes, and hair base, will be removed.  Only use this option if you're sure what you are selecting is the complete outfit you want.

Sometimes, even if you've removed an item, it will appear to return briefly.  I usually see this with system skirts, though, not with attachments.

Did you make this part of an Outfit in Appearance?  That'll do it every time.  Are they part of an outfit?  You may have to wear tthe outfit first and then take off and replace them with something else.

Finally, when was the last time you cleared your Cache?  Be prepared for a LONG log in afterwards, but many linked items will no longer be linked (like outfits).

Clear Visible Cache first:  that is a script you use to clean up visible things.

Clear Cache: The big time fix up.  Be sure of what and where that cache is and where its located.  Clearing your Cache will remove EVERYTHING in the cache file, so if you have other stuff in the file, move it first.

Those two bits of clearing should fix your problems.  Just remember Clear Cache = Long load afterwards.

Why would linked items like outfits no longer be linked on clearing cache? The cache is merely a local folder on your computer and soon as you clear it and log in, your inventory including linked outfits will be downloaded again from the server. I've never heard of anyone having an issue with linked items becoming unlinked after clearing cache.

To avoid a longer log in while the viewer is clearing cache, just delete the cache folder in AppData instead of clicking the clear cache button. Unless you have a huge inventory, it  should reload in a few minutes after logging in especially if you log in to a low lag Linden water sim like Smith.

Edit: Regarding 'clear visible cache' scripts to try and force the sim to update nearby visible objects, I believe you can achieve the same effect by changing groups.
